Debra Messing

Debra Messing

Milestones

  • Birthplace: Brooklyn, New York, USA
  • Birthday: August 15, 1968
  • 2008

    Featured in Diane English's female ensemble "The Women," a remake of the 1936 play by Clare Boothe Luce

  • 2008

    Reprised the role of Molly Kagan in the USA series, "The Starter Wife"; earned a Golden Globe nomination for Best Actress in a Comedy Series in 2009

  • 2007

    Played the lead in the USA mini-series, "The Starter Wife"; earned Emmy, Golden Globe and SAG nominations for Best Actress

  • 2006

    Voiced forest ranger, Beth in the animated comedy, "Open Season"

  • 2005

    Starred with Dermot Mulroney in the romantic comedy "The Wedding Date"

  • 2004

    Cast as Ben Stiller's cheating wife in "Along Came Polly"

  • 2004

    Voiced Arlene, Garfield's girlfriend in "Garfield: The Movie"

  • 2002

    Appeared opposite Woody Allen in "Hollywood Ending"

  • 2002

    Cast opposite Richard Gere in "The Mothman Prophecies"

  • 2000

    Starred as Mary Magdalene in the CBS miniseries "Jesus"

  • 1998

    Cast in a small role as a journalist in Woody Allen's "Celebrity"

  • 1998 to 2006

    Co-starred opposite Eric McCormack in the NBC sitcom "Will & Grace"; earned Emmy (2000, 2001, 2006), Golden Globe (2002, 2003, 2004) and SAG (2004) nominations for Best Actress in a Comedy

  • 1998

    Replaced Sherilyn Fenn in the short-lived ABC series "Prey"

  • 1997

    Made a guest appearance as Jerry's unavailable crush on an episode of "Seinfeld" (NBC)

  • 1996

    Played the female lead in "McHale's Navy" opposite Tom Arnold

  • 1995

    Feature film debut in "A Walk in the Clouds"

  • 1995 to 1999

    Starred as Stacey Colbert, a liberal journalist who enters into a marriage of convenience in the FOX sitcom "Ned and Stacey"

  • 1994

    Appeared Off-Broadway in "Four Dogs and a Bone" and "The Naked Truth"

  • 1994 to 1995

    Had recurring role of scheming Dana Abandando on "NYPD Blue" (ABC)

  • Gained attention of entertainment industry as Harper Pitt in student workshop production of "Angels in America: Perestroika"

  • Made professional stage debut in production of "The Importance of Being Earnest" at Seattle's Intiman Theatre

  • Raised in East Greenwich, RI
